OnTrac is hiring a Maintenance Technician 2 – Conveyor Systems

Founded in 1986, OnTrac has evolved into the leading provider of same-day and next-day delivery services in the U.S. for premier e-commerce and product-supply businesses, including five of the largest retailers in the U.S. 

 

Location: 2559 Consulate Drive, Orlando, FL 32819

Pay: $30.00 - 36.00/ hr. (DOE) 

Shift: Wednesday to Saturday from 12:00 pm to 10:30 pm

The Must-Haves:

  • High school diploma or general education degree (GED) preferred. 

  • 1+ years related experience and/or training in mechanical and electrical equipment, or equivalent combination of both education and specific work experience. 

  • Welding experience is required

  • Current Driver's License and clean driving record  

Your Mission in Motion:

  • Ensure proper operation of conveyor systems, and material handling equipment to keep our operations running smoothly, responding in a timely manner to all material handling systems breakdowns

  • Maintain and provide routine preventive maintenance to conveyor systems

  • Change and repair parts of conveyor systems, rebuild and align equipment, gears, shafts, pulleys, and belts

  • Use illustrated parts breakdown manuals and operational manuals in the repair, modification, and maintenance of equipment

  • Perform housekeeping duties, including work area clean-up, conveyor and equipment clean-up, and other general housekeeping duties as assigned

  • Daily Inspections of machinery for potential problems

  • From time to time, you may be called in after hours to ensure our MHS (conveyor) systems are working at optimum capacity

  • Maintain and contribute to a safe work environment by adhering to policies and procedures as outlined in the Company Safety Program

  • Most of the work is performed independently, but from time to time you will need to tap the shoulder of another OnTrac maintenance member, we work as a team!

 

Paving your way to your success:

  • Ability to learn and follow all safety regulations and job instructions to perform primary duties

  • Knowledge of Material Handling Systems (MHS), industrial conveyor systems and controls, VFDs, PLC, Electronic motors (480V). Programming, GUI and or HMI experience is a big plus

  • Knowledge of LOTO (Lock Out Tag Out), PM’s (Preventative Maintenance), and 3-Phase electrical work

  • Ability to read and understand schematics and electrical blueprints

  • Mechanical work experience   

  • Industrial electrical knowledge a PLUS 

  • Welding experience a plus 

  • Knowledge of OSHA requirements  

  • Ability to maintain a flexible schedule to accommodate 24 hr. operations; occasionally work extended hours, weekends and holidays as needed

  • Ability to lift 60 pounds on a routine basis

  • Good time management skills and ability to work independently and as a team
